MassChallenge FinTech Challenge Program

Offers equity-free startup acceleration in the United States for financial technology teams collaborating with industry partners.

MassChallengeUnited StatesPrize

The FinTech Challenge Program is an annual 4-month equity-free cohort based in Boston, connecting scaling fintech startups with leading US financial institutions. Corporate challenge-holders for 2026 include Citizens Financial Group (GenAI, agentic banking, planetary risk), DCU (stablecoin payments, AI fraud), Massachusetts Bankers Association (deposit growth, workforce), MassMutual (AI/digital enablement, fraud), and The Hartford (next-gen distribution, risk assessment). Accepted companies attend four mandatory in-person Boston sessions (matchmaking Jan 13–14, orientation, mid-program, finale) plus bi-weekly virtual check-ins. No equity is taken. The application window runs Oct–Oct; the 2026 cycle deadline was October 14, 2025. FY2027 cycle expected fall 2026.
